Maine Code § 5-472

Purposes

The purposes of this program are: [PL 2005, c. 656, §1 (NEW).]
1. Selection. To attract and select college students with ambition and talent for temporary
internships within county and local governments;
[PL 2005, c. 656, §1 (NEW).]
2. Placement. To place each program intern in a position of some responsibility where the intern
can contribute ideas, enthusiasm and ingenuity while completing a project under the direction of a
responsible county or local administrator;
[PL 2005, c. 656, §1 (NEW).]
3. Liaison. To encourage liaisons between county and local governments and the various
institutions of higher learning located within the State; and
[PL 2005, c. 656, §1 (NEW).]
4. Recommendations. To formulate recommendations for improving the program and for
attracting college graduates with outstanding potential into permanent positions of employment within
county and local governments.
[PL 2005, c. 656, §1 (NEW).]
